Fermentation Characteristics and Silage Quality of Oil Palm Frond and Indigofera zollingeriana Mixture with Molasses Addition

ABSTRACT
Oil palm fronds have high fiber and low digestibility; thus, they were mixed with Indigofera zollingeriana and fermented using molasses to improve silage quality. This study aimed to evaluate the effect of molasses addition on the quality of oil palm frond–Indigofera zollingeriana silage. A Completely Randomized Design (CRD) with five treatments and five replications was used, consisting of molasses levels of 0%, 1.50%, 3%, 4.50%, and 6% of dry matter. Observed variables included dry matter (DM), dry matter loss (DML), pH, and Fleigh value (FV), analyzed using ANOVA and DMRT at a 5% level. Molasses addition significantly affected DM, DML, pH, and FV. The 6% molasses treatment (P5) produced the best silage quality with the highest DM (31.7±1.28), lowest DML (3.32±1.28), lowest pH (4.31±0.71), and highest FV (98.9±0.71).
